FITTING THE AREA OVERRIDE SENSOR
The area override sensor stops the area counter when the implement is not in
operation. Most implements use the three-point linkage and are raised/lowered, so
the most universal solution is to fit the area override sensor on the lift arms.
The sensor can be fitted in other positions (PTO handle, hydraulic cylinder
handles, etc.) as long as there is a mechanical movement of min. 50-mm. The
distance between the sensor and the magnet must not exceed 5 mm.
An electrical signal from, i.e. electrically controlled lift arms, sprayer switch box,
etc. can be used as an area override sensor. The signal must change to 0V
(ground) when the area counter is to be stopped.
